Harashankarpur - Panskura, Purba Medinipur
Harashankarpur is a village situated in the Panskura subdivision of Purba Medinipur district, West Bengal. Haur serves as the Gram Panchayat for Harashankarpur village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Harashankarpur is 344245. The village covers a total geographical area of 92.84 hectares and falls under the 721131 pincode. Tamluk is the nearest town, located about 31 km away.
Harashankarpur village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.
Population of Harashankarpur
As per Census 2011, Harashankarpur village has a total population of 1,198 people, consisting of 622 males and 576 females. The village has 297 households and a sex ratio of 926 females per 1,000 males. There are 113 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 952 literate and 246 illiterate residents. Additionally, 39 people belong to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Harashankarpur are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 1,198 | 622 | 576 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 113 | 61 | 52 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 39 | 15 | 24 |
| Literate Population | 952 | 532 | 420 |
| Illiterate Population | 246 | 90 | 156 |

Transport and Connectivity of Harashankarpur
Harashankarpur is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Haur, while the nearest airport is Behala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 55.2 km.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Railway Station | No | Available within 5-10 km |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Tamluk to Harashankarpur is about 31 km, with a usual travel time of around 1-1.25 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.

Health Facilities in Harashankarpur
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Harashankarpur village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| Yes | Available within village |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within 2-5 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within >10 km |
